House vote: H.R. 1954 // May 31, 2011Needed two-thirds to pass

To implement the President’s request to increase the statutory limit on the public debt

Sponsor: DAVE CAMP (R-MI)

7 trillion.

Economics and Public Finance Topic assigned by the Congressional Research Service.

Who won, and how much of the country was behind them

Won the vote · Nay

318 votes, representing 176,112,709 people74.3%of U.S. adults

Lost the vote · Yea

97 votes, representing 50,356,837 people21.2%of U.S. adults

The dotted gap is 4.5% of U.S. adults whose member did not vote, voted “present,” or whose seat was vacant.
